Wild Mushroom Hunter will need a License in Pennsylvania

Many people love to collect and eat wild mushrooms. They enjoy hiking in the woods, being surrounded by nature. The problem is that there are so many good eating mushrooms that have look a likes. Every year many people end up in hospitals after eating a bad mushroom. Unfortunately many people die.
Governor Wolf wants the State House of Representatives to draft a bill that would require mushroom hunters to take classes and be certified through county extension offices around the state. If passed the bill would require individuals to complete a ten hour course at mushroom identification.. the cost of the class is expected to cost approximately two hundred and fifty dollars and would have to be renewed each year
